My Listings (1)

Aerial View at 17111 Biscayne Boulevard, Unit 2208, North Miami Beach, FL 33160, listed by Claudine De Bolle, MLS ID: AX-11794561
active
17111 Biscayne Boulevard, Unit 2208, North Miami Beach, FL 33160
1,750 Sqft
2 beds
2/1 baths